Aerobic respiration and photosynthesis are interrelated because they are complementary processes. Photosynthesis in plants produces oxygen and glucose using sunlight, while aerobic respiration in animals and plants uses oxygen and glucose to produce energy, releasing carbon dioxide and water as byproducts. Essentially, the oxygen and glucose produced during photosynthesis are used as inputs for aerobic respiration, and the carbon dioxide produced during respiration is used as an input for photosynthesis.

Respiration is a metabolic process in cells that releases energy from glucose and produces carbon dioxide and water as byproducts. Photosynthesis, on the other hand, is a process in plants that converts light energy into chemical energy stored in glucose, releasing oxygen as a byproduct. Together, these processes are interconnected in the carbon cycle, as plants use the glucose produced in photosynthesis for respiration, and animals use the oxygen produced during photosynthesis for respiration.
Oxygen, Carbon Dioxide, water, and ADP/ATP are all recycled during photosynthesis and respiration. Energy is not recycled so there must be a continuous supply of energy to maintain the cycle.
The waste substances produced by aerobic respiration include carbon dioxide and water. Carbon dioxide is released as a byproduct of the breakdown of glucose during the process of respiration, while water is produced as a result of the combination of hydrogen ions and oxygen in the electron transport chain.
